Manufacturer's product description
Benefit from brighter images, flexible features for flawless viewing, easy placement and advanced multimedia connectivity. All in a compact business projector, with whisper-quiet operation. An ultra high 2, 500 ANSI lumens and true XGA resolution gives superior viewing in all light conditions. Six image settings provide perfect picture adjustment for data and video projection. Switch to hi-contrast mode to make graphs and photographs look sharper. Cinema mode is ideal for watching films in a darkened room. While custom mode lets you fine-tune several factors, including adjusting images that are too light or too dark. Canon's Auto Image mode is especially useful for video and DVD projection in darkened rooms. When black areas on a screen are a shade too light, the projector automatically adjusts lamp brightness to bring out a pure black effect. When a projector is placed at an angle to the screen it can cause image distortion. The LV-7215 features both horizontal and vertical Keystone Correction to overcome this problem, providing distortion-free images. Conventional projectors use interlaced scanning to produce a single frame, often resulting in wavy lines on the screen. Canon's new Progressive Scanning reduces flickering when connected to an interlaced signal. This results in smoother movement, clear diagonal lines and super-sharp titles. You can easily connect the projector to virtually any multimedia equipment. A DVI-D interface gives a direct digital connection to compatible PCs and DVD players, for a clearer picture. A high quality component video connection supports VCR, DVD and High Definition TV projection. An optional SCART connector accepts a wide range of devices, including digital camcorders and game consoles. When projecting in small rooms, the LV-7215 can be set up very close to the screen - and still produce a large, clear image. The new projection lens also offers a 1.6x manual zoom, by far the largest in its class. This ensures easy placement as you can obtain the ideal image size from a remarkably wide range of distances. Silent mode (only 35dB) keeps operating noise down to a strict minimum. Other advantages include customized logo placement at the start of each session and an optional Multi-Card Imager for network connectivity.
